Mizoram Celebrates Olympic Day with Runs and Tree Planting

Photo Courtesy: northeasttoday

Aizawl: Mizoram marked International Olympic Day on Tuesday with a morning run and a massive planting drive at Lammual. The event kicked off at 7:00 a.m. sharp. State Environment Minister Lalthansanga and Sports Minister Lalnghinglova Hmar led the proceedings.

The gathering promoted fitness, sports, and green initiatives. Hmar thanked the Mizoram Olympic Association for keeping the annual tradition alive. He pointed to the state's potential to produce future world-class competitors. "I hope that one day, we will not only celebrate the Olympics, but also witness Mizo athletes proudly representing India at the Olympic Games," Hmar said.

Citizens from all walks of life joined the celebration. The day served as a call to action for local athletes. Officials want to see Mizo talent on the global stage soon.
